Transaction 696154471082626bad679f0fa22686541e25ec4e906650596f1979ccc7752126
1 Input
1 Output
-
696154471082626bad679f0fa22686541e25ec4e906650596f1979ccc7752126:0
- value
- 4287750
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d43f660796d1fa30b3750d3a7dca30b36e05871 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12D9Cc5YDbD7GKqD41YY5JXjFLUt6XFWY4